Finding DQ11 slightly harder than I remember/always read about, and feel like it's massively a result of the forge. by WayToTheDawn63 in dragonquest

[–]pinkaces39 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I found myself playing with Super Strong Monsters and Super Shypox a lot. It is super easy to over level and hit 99. I usually hit level 60 by the end of Act 1 without trying. I usually craft recipes as I get them and reforge any unique items and rewards, like the mini medal rewards and things like that. They help a lot, especially immediately after you get them. I usually never worry about status ailments in combat, maybe stun occasionally. Also, if you need to quickly level up, avoid hunting for metal slimes past act 1. I prefer farming the metal hardy hand in the Manglegrove whale way station in acts 2 and 3. They appear super frequently and give great XP, but you can farm them without any hunting or pep powers or whatever.

two things I don't understand about the spell-casting archetypes by DarthMcConnor42 in Pathfinder2e

[–]pinkaces39 11 points12 points  (0 children)

Summoner can get 10th level spells with a class feat, "Legendary Summoner." It allows the summoner to sacrifice a 9th level spell slit to cast a summon spell heightened to 10th level.
